The Art and Science of Nutritional Labeling

Nutritional labeling provides purchasers with vital details about the makeup of the items they take. This science involves a mix of legal requirements and scientific expertise to ensure that tags are understandable and precise. Understanding the principles behind nutritional labeling can enable buyers to make savvy selections about their diet.

  • Important components are shown prominently, such as energy, fat, starches, and protein.{
  • Serving sizes are mentioned to give a consistent basis for comparison between different products.
  • Ingredient lists are arranged by decreasing order of amount to clarify the principal components.{

Supplementary information, such as vitamins, allergen warnings, and production details, may also be included to improve the tag's thoroughness.
